Caramel Apple Pie Pecan Bars

Cultural Context
Caramel Apple Pie Pecan Bars blend the classic flavors of apple pie with the richness of caramel and pecans, making them a beloved treat in the United States, especially during the fall season. These bars are often enjoyed at gatherings and celebrations, reflecting the comfort and warmth of homemade desserts. With their sweet and nutty profile, they are a delightful twist on traditional apple pie, appealing to both young and old alike.

Preheat the oven to 300 degrees Fahrenheit.
In a saucepan over medium heat, add 1 cup of granulated sugar and stir for about 10 minutes until it melts and turns light brown.
Switch to a whisk and add 6 tablespoons of salted butter carefully, as it will bubble and boil.
Add 1/2 cup of heavy cream, stirring continuously, and let it boil for about a minute.
Turn off the heat and add 1/2 teaspoon of fine sea salt, stirring until smooth. Let it cool covered on an unused burner.
In a bowl, mix 1 cup of all-purpose flour, 1/4 cup of granulated sugar, and 1/4 teaspoon of fine sea salt.
In another bowl, combine 8 teaspoons of melted unsalted butter and 1 teaspoon of vanilla extract, then pour this into the dry ingredients and stir until it forms a dough.
Spread the dough evenly in a greased 8 by 8 inch pan and bake for 15 minutes at 300 degrees Fahrenheit.
Peel and core 3 large honey crisp apples, slice them into half-inch pieces, and place them in a bowl.
To the apples, add 2 tablespoons of all-purpose flour, 2 tablespoons of granulated sugar, 1 teaspoon of cinnamon, and 1/8 teaspoon of ground nutmeg, mixing until combined.
Remove the crust from the oven and increase the oven temperature to 350 degrees Fahrenheit.
In a bowl, combine 1/4 cup of all-purpose flour, 1/2 cup of rolled oats, 1/3 cup of packed brown sugar, and 1/4 teaspoon of cinnamon, mixing well.
Add 4 tablespoons of cold unsalted butter cut into cubes and mix until the mixture forms crumbles.
Assemble the bars by spreading the apple filling over the pre-cooked crust and smoothing it out evenly.
Spread the streusel topping over the apple filling as evenly as possible.
Bake in the oven at 350 degrees Fahrenheit for 30 minutes until the top is golden brown; broil for an additional 2 minutes if necessary.
Let the bars cool for about half an hour, then chop 1 cup of raw unsalted pecans using a pastry blender.
Sprinkle the chopped pecans evenly over the top of the bars.
Cover the bars and refrigerate for 2 hours to firm up before cutting.
Cut the bars into 9 squares (3 by 3) and drizzle heated caramel over the top of each bar.
